How The Sweet Spot Weed Dispensary in Santa Rosa Offers Custom Assistance and Top-notch Marijuana for Each Client
The Sweet Spot Weed Dispensary Piner Road - Santa Rosa 925 Piner Rd, Santa Rosa, CA 95403, United States +17078435148 Key Takeaway Sweet Spot Cannabis Shop, located on Piner Road in Santa Rosa, CA, provides a comfortable setting for cannabis lovers of all expertise. Renowned for its friendly and informed staff and a divers